How to query twitter API with respect to time using Tweepy?












-2















I have access to Twitter's API, and I'm using the Tweepy module to query tweets. However, I can't figure out how to search tweets in a specific time slot, like march 1st - july 20th.

The Twitter API only allows you to query back in time for 7 days, see the API documentation. That is, unless you pay for that extra access.
